Securitas AB Inventory-to-Revenue Calculation

Inventory-to-Revenue determines the ability of a company to manage their inventory levels. It measures the percentage of Inventories the company currently has on hand to support the current amount of Revenue.

Securitas AB's Inventory-to-Revenue for the fiscal year that ended in Dec. 2023 is calculated as

Inventory-to-Revenue (A: Dec. 2023 )
=Average Total Inventories / Revenue
=( (Total Inventories (A: Dec. 2022 ) + Total Inventories (A: Dec. 2023 )) / count ) / Revenue (A: Dec. 2023 )
=( (156.581 + 140.676) / 2 ) / 15329.999
=148.6285 / 15329.999
=0.01

Securitas AB's Inventory-to-Revenue for the quarter that ended in Dec. 2023 is calculated as

Inventory-to-Revenue (Q: Dec. 2023 )
=Average Total Inventories / Revenue
=( (Total Inventories (Q: Sep. 2023 ) + Total Inventories (Q: Dec. 2023 )) / count ) / Revenue (Q: Dec. 2023 )
=( (0 + 140.676) / 1 ) / 3854.898
=140.676 / 3854.898
=0.04

Securitas AB  (OTCPK:SCTBF) Inventory-to-Revenue Explanation

An increase in Inventory-to-Revenue from one quarter to the next indicates that one of the following is happening:

1. investment in inventory is growing more rapidly than revenue
2. revenue are dropping
No matter which situation is causing the problem, an increase in the Inventory-to-Revenue may signal an oncoming cash flow problem.

Likewise, a decrease in the Inventory-to-Revenue from one quarter to next indicates that one of these is occurring:

1. investment in inventory is shrinking in relation to revenue
2. revenue are increasing
No matter which situation is causing the reduction in the Inventory-to-Revenue, either one suggests that business's inventory levels and its cash flow are effectively managed.

Securitas AB (Securitas AB) Business Description

Address
Lindhagensplan 70, PO Box 12307, Stockholm, SWE, SE-102 28
Securitas is an international security services, consulting, and investigation group based in Stockholm, Sweden. Its primary activities are centered on manned security, mobile security, monitoring, and risk assessment. Securitas operates in more than 50 countries and is the second-largest security firm in the world and the largest in manned guarding.
